| Summary: | media-libs/mlt has executable stacks | ||
|---|---|---|---|
| Product: | Gentoo Linux | Reporter: | afrodocter <afrobrothers> |
| Component: | [OLD] Library | Assignee: | Gentoo Media-video project <media-video> |
| Status: | RESOLVED TEST-REQUEST | ||
| Severity: | normal | CC: | dima |
| Priority: | High | ||
| Version: | unspecified | ||
| Hardware: | x86 | ||
| OS: | Linux | ||
| Whiteboard: | |||
| Package list: | Runtime testing required: | --- | |
|
Description
afrodocter
2007-05-22 12:55:19 UTC
I had the same problem with mlt-0.2.4 and I fixed it using: http://www.gentoo.org/proj/en/hardened/gnu-stack.xml by adding the code in Code Listing 6.1 at the end of these two files: src/modules/gtk2/have_mmx.S src/modules/gtk2/scale_line_22_yuv_mmx.S and doing ebuild compile install qmerge. After this I didn't see the crashes I used to when navigating forward in a movie in kdenlive 0.5. Maybe someone could create a patch, put it in the e-build and also submit it upstream to mlt. I never added a patch to an ebuild so I don't want to spend to much time. Well I still see some crashes, but I think they aren't as frequent. I can't see any executable stack-related issues with a modern (0.2.4-r2) version of this ebuild. Should this bug really persist today? These versions are not in Portage anymore, please test >= mlt-0.3.2 and up. |